Hey everyone,

I was running my Facebook Ads smoothly, and on January 23rd, I realized that there was a duplicate campaign (campaign with the same name as my campaign) running with a very high budget. I checked, and a Russian ad was running from my account. I turned it off and checked if another user was added to my Business Manager, but there wasn't any, which meant my own account was hacked. I changed the password and shifted the authenticator to a different device. The ad was automatically on the next day. I contacted Facebook support and deactivated my credit card, but it was too late as transactions of 2 X $600 and 2 X $900 were already made. I asked FB support for help, but they kept postponing the request by saying they already knew about this issue and forwarded my case to their internal team. I even got a call from them, but they didn't assure me if I would get the amount back or not. It's been 3 months now, and I'm feeling hopeless. Have any of you guys faced the same issue? Did you get a refund for the same? What can be done in my case?

Thanks

In your case, i think the attacker is still in your BM, let’s check your Admins and check to your Page and Instagram section to see something wrong there. If not, check your account once again.

For the money, have you ever reported to your bank for the refund?
 
Request charge back to your credit card issuer but Facebook wouldn't like that
 
you changed your profile login but it still happens the next night? or change cookies because hackers may have used cookies to log into your account. you should also enable FB's 2Fa authentication to make things more secure. Report the amount to the bank. they will assist you to request FB to return the money to you sooner
